Aircraft Boeing B77W is registered in Netherlands with tail number PH-BVS. It is operated by KLM Cargo and its age is 8 years (built in 2017). The aircraft weight is 159570 kg and it has 2 engines Jet with power of 400,3 kN kN each. The length of the plane is 73.8 m. The height of the plane is 18.51 m. The wing span is 60.93 m.
